OVERVIEW 1. Ethnic geography studies the spatial distributions and interactions of ethnic groups—populations distinguished by common origins and distinctive cultural or racial traits. Ethnicity is a spatial concept; recognized homeland areas, urban enclaves, or rural settlement districts are the rule. 2.

In the analysis of ethnic separatism and secession,' two approaches can be. distinguished. One is to ask what forces are responsbile for the general up- surge in secessionist movements, from Burma to Biafra and Bangladesh, from Corsica to Quebec, and from Eritrea to the Southern Philippines.2 Another approach is to ask what moves certain ...

See examples of ETHNIC CLEANSING used in a sentence.Ethnic separatism has been viewed differently during the Cold War years, after the Cold War, and in the post-9/11 era. Most ethnic conflicts did not become part of ‘high politics’ of the two superpowers. The only exception was the Arab–Israeli conflict, if it were to be considered as an ethnic conflict at all.Political process is defined as the process of the formulation and administration of public policy usually by interaction between social groups and political institutions or between political leadership and public opinion [2].
